The 2022 WAFL Women's season was the fourth season of the WAFL Women's (WAFLW). The season commenced on 19 February and concluded with the Grand Final on 2 July 2022. West Perth made their debut in the competition, increasing the league's size to seven clubs. Claremont won the premiership, and defeated East Fremantle by 8 points in the grand final.
